Recap: Jefferson Panthers vs. Manhattan Tigers
The Jefferson Panthers and the Manhattan Tigers squared off in some playoff action on Saturday, but sadly the Jefferson Panthers had to settle for second. Jefferson took a 24-7 bruising from Manhattan. Jefferson's loss signaled the end of their three-game winning streak.
Tyzer Zody threw for 80 yards on seven of 20 attempts. Parker Wagner was his top target, picking up 42 receiving yards. On the ground, Jack Johnson rushed for 40 yards and a touchdown.
Jefferson's defeat dropped their record down to 7-5. As for Manhattan, they have yet to lose a game at home this season, leaving them with a 11-1 record.
Jefferson does not have any more games scheduled as of now. Manhattan will be playing at home against Florence-Carlton at 1:00 p.m. on Saturday. Florence-Carlton has been dominant on offense recently, as they've racked up an incredible 521 points over their last 11 games.
